A leading diagnostics company is seeking a Workflow and Informatics Specialist for the SEA region. The role involves supporting automation sales, project management, and providing training to customers. Candidates should have a degree in science or biomedical engineering and experience in clinical lab settings. Strong analytical skills with tools like MS Excel and good interpersonal abilities are essential. This role also offers flexibility for remote work arrangements.

As a global leader in clinical diagnostics, Beckman Coulter Diagnostics has challenged convention to elevate the diagnostic laboratory’s role in improving patient health for more than 90 years. Our diagnostic solutions are used in routine and complex clinical testing, and are used in hospitals, reference and research laboratories, and physician offices around the world. Every hour around the world, more than one million tests are run on Beckman Coulter Diagnostics systems, impacting 1.2 billion patients and more than three million clinicians per year. Workflow and Informatics Specialist, SEA for Beckman Coulter Diagnostics is responsible for providing end-to-end support to sales, marketing and post-sales teams within each SEA country for automation accounts and prospects, including but not limited to technical layout preparation and validation, automation product value proposition as well as automation forecast planning. He/she must be a customer-centric individual who could transform the voice of customers into effective product solutions that would serve to meet their operational needs as well as long-term financial goals.
